Integration and tech

No. Paylead is a SaaS platform. Your bank calls REST APIs and consumes Webhooks. In some cases you may also use our white-labelled WebApp as a touchpoint in your own mobile app. 
On Cashback or Loyalty reward, latency depends on how often you push transactions to Paylead. The more frequent your integration’s cadence, the closer to real-time the Consumer experience feels. Most Rewards surface as pending within minutes after Offer usage.
Yes. Offers can be scoped to specific Segments and Campaigns, allowing different Cashback rates per audience, for example on Premium users.
Yes. The Paylead sandbox exposes the same endpoints, payloads, and behaviors as production. The only differences are isolation (no real payouts), a separate base URL and Offer contents. See Environments.
